This sweet property is the perfect base to enjoy a relaxing getaway or active break, perfectly positioned for exploring the spectacular Afan Forest Park, popular with walkers and cyclists.

Nestled in the confluence of rivers Afan and Pelenna and surrounded by lush Welsh countryside, this traditional terraced property has been stylishly renovated into a welcoming holiday home. An array of scenic walks and cycle routes are nearby through the Afan Valley, making this cottage perfect for two couples or a family looking for outdoor adventures with their furry best friends.

 

With a useful entrance hallway for leaving wet boots and leads, the living space flows pleasantly together, with a dining table, lounge area, and spacious kitchen with range oven. Dogs and humans alike will love cosying up around the wood burner after long days of exploring, with a tasty stew simmering in the oven. And there’s a large TV for those lazy evenings when only a film will do. The smart bedrooms can be configured to suit your group and there’s ample space to spread out in the bathroom. Cyclists will be happy to find a secure storeroom in the courtyard garden, where there’s room for surfboards, canoes and other outdoor gear too. The private garden also makes a great spot for an early morning coffee, while the pups sniff out the new day and birds chime their dawn chorus.

 

The house is just 300 metres from the Richard Burton Trail and the famous viaduct, and there are several other trails within easy reach too - including those in the spectacular Afan Forest Park. Take a trip to Margam Country Park, 7 miles away, and let the dogs explore the parkland before enjoying a pamper in the self-service dog wash, or blow away the cobwebs on the 3-mile long stretch of beach at Aberavon Sands near Port Talbot (6 miles), with beautiful views over Swansea Bay.
